Columbia High School announced its valedictorian Lincoln Gipson ’26 and salutatorians Manyata Madan ’26 and Natalie Perkins ’26 for the Class of 2026 at the Columbian Awards on Thursday evening. All three students have had accomplished high school careers, including weighted GPAs over 100.
Valedictorian
Lincoln Gipson
Lincoln Gipson is a member of the National Honor Society, Peer Leadership, Columbia Kicks Cancer, Math League, and the track and field team. He is also a volunteer firefighter with the East Greenbush Fire Company.
Lincoln will attend Northeastern University in the fall where he will study mechanical engineering.
Salutatorian
Manyata Madan
Manyata Madan is a member of the National Honor Society, Rho Kappa Social Studies Honor Society, and Science Olympiad. She serves as co-Editor-in-Chief of the Devils Advocate and treasurer for Amnesty International. And she was a student member on the Cell Phone Committee which helped develop plans for implementing Distraction-Free Learning in the East Greenbush Central School District.
Manyata will attend the University of Illinois Urbana Champaign this fall. She plans to pursue a career in data science.
Salutatorian
Natalie Perkins
Natalie Perkins is a member of the National Honor Society, Rho Kappa Social Studies Honor Society, Chamber Singers, and the Student Help Desk. She is enrolled in the New Visions Emergency Preparedness, Informatics, Cyber, and Homeland Security program through Questar III BOCES.
Natalie will attend the University at Albany in the fall where she will study linguistics and international relations.
